Anna Phoebe Wright

BirthJune 1839 - Edgefield County, South Carolina
Death1914 - Aiken County, South Carolina, USA
MotherNancy Virginia Howell
FatherJacob Wright ♣

Born in Edgefield County, South Carolina on June 1839 to Jacob Wright ♣ and Nancy Virginia Howell. Anna Phoebe Wright married Amos Watson Satcher and had 6 children. She passed away on 1914 in Aiken County, South Carolina, USA.
